MICRO STYLI.

BY GOEKELER.

Micro styli for 3D coordinate measuring machines have been specially developed for tactile measuring tasks with extremely small or difficult-to-access geometries such as the measuring of very small bores and delicate contours.

Maximum strength of the ball-shaft
connection thanks to Vacuum Styli
Technology
. The vacuum brazing
process is particularly effective and
reliable for small balls.

SMALL IN SIZE.
BIG IN PERFORMANCE.

Ball diameter: 0.08 - 0.15 mm

Stylus with carbide ball

Breaking force 50 - 100 mN 

Ball diameter: 0.2 - 0.8 mm

Stylus with ruby ball

Breaking force 2 - 3 N

Robust stepped design

for maximum stability

With thread M2, M3, M4, M5

or available without thread

AREAS OF APPLICATION. MICRO STYLI.

Micromechanics & precision engineering

Measurement of filigree components e.g. in watches, sensors or medical technology components.

Electronics & semiconductor industry

Measurement of printed circuit boards, chips, contact surfaces and other fine structures.

Tool & mold making

Inspection of complex or deep cavities in molds.

Automotive & aviation

Measurements on miniature parts or
highly angled areas.

CLEANING.

HANDLING.

Micro styli must be handled with extreme care to prevent deformation or damage to the ball or shaft. A clean measuring environment and protection from dust and dirt particles are recommended, as even the smallest contaminants can affect measurement accuracy.
